    Web module blocks Folding@Home from getting WU's.

    I need to disable http checking for F@H to get new WU's. I thought of adding their servers IP to exclude but there are too many.

    cut from F@H's log:

    15:17:43:Connecting to assign-GPU.stanford.edu:8080
    15:17:44:WARNING: Failed to get ID from 'assign-GPU.stanford.edu:8080': Server responded: HTTP_UNKNOWN
    15:17:44:ERROR: Exception: Could not get an assignment ID

    Cut from nod32:

    31/07/2011 11:17:44 AM No usable rule found 171.67.108.201:8080 192.168.0.2:52635 TCP
    31/07/2011 11:17:43 AM No usable rule found 171.67.108.201:80 192.168.0.2:52634 TCP
    31/07/2011 11:17:43 AM No usable rule found 171.67.108.201:8080 192.168.0.2:52633 TCP
